1What is the typical cost range for professional cabinet installation in Florence, and what factors influence the price?

In the Florence area, professional cabinet installation typically ranges from $1,500 to $5,000+, with the final cost heavily dependent on the scope of the project. Key factors include the complexity of the layout (common in older Florence homes), the type of cabinets (stock vs. custom), and whether the job includes removal of old cabinets or just installation of new ones. Local labor rates and the seasonal demand for contractors during our drier summer months can also affect pricing.

2How does Florence's coastal climate affect cabinet material selection and installation?

Florence's high humidity and salty air require special consideration for cabinet longevity. We strongly recommend using moisture-resistant materials like marine-grade plywood for boxes, and finishes that are specifically formulated for high-humidity environments to prevent warping, swelling, or mold. Proper installation must also account for this by ensuring adequate sealing and ventilation in the kitchen or bathroom to mitigate moisture buildup.

3Are there specific permits or regulations in Florence, OR, I need to be aware of for a cabinet installation?

For a simple cabinet replacement that doesn't alter plumbing or electrical layouts, a permit is usually not required from the City of Florence. However, if your project involves moving plumbing lines, gas lines, or electrical outlets as part of a kitchen remodel, you will likely need permits. It's always best to check with the Florence Community Development Department, as regulations can vary, especially for homes in flood zones or historic districts.

5What is a realistic timeline for a cabinet installation project in Florence, from ordering to completion?

The timeline can vary significantly. For stock cabinets, the process from measurement to installation can take 4-8 weeks, while custom cabinets can take 8-16 weeks or more due to manufacturing and shipping. It's crucial to plan around the rainy season (October-April), as delivery delays can occur, and scheduling reliable contractors can be more challenging during the peak summer tourism and construction season. Always build in a buffer for unforeseen delays.
